Which prompt indicates that a user has not filled out required information during data loading?

Explanation:
When required fields aren’t filled during a data load, the system enforces validation and blocks progress with an error prompt. This clearly signals that something essential is missing and must be corrected before the load can continue. Warnings aren’t enough to stop the process; they merely flag potential issues. Confirmation prompts are about getting user approval to proceed, and information prompts simply share details without enforcing completion. So the prompt that best indicates missing required information is the error prompt.
